Soil macrofauna play an important role in maintaining soil quality and fertility, including through improving aeration, water absorption, and the dispersal and decomposition of organic matter. The presence of macrofauna is also an effective biological indicator to assess soil conditions ecologically. This study aims to assess soil quality based on the diversity of macrofauna species found in landfill areas in Semarang City. The approach used was quantitative method with sampling technique using pitfall trap at three points of observation location. Based on the identification results, 11 species of macrofauna were found with a total of 85 individuals. The diversity index value in diurnal and nocturnal communities showed a medium category, indicating a fairly good species diversity although uneven. The average index values for both time groups were relatively equal, reflecting the stability of the macrofauna community in the two periods of daily activity. Sites with good natural vegetation tended to have higher soil quality, while areas directly exposed to landfill activities showed degraded soil quality due to lack of vegetation cover and high inorganic waste content.
